TURN-208: Gatevale turnstile counters at the Merrow Field pilot double-count when a rotation reverses mid-cycle. Attendance totals drift roughly 2% high per event. The debounce window fix is implemented, reviewed by Ilsa, and soak-tested across two simulated match days without drift. Ready for your cut; the candidate build is identified below.

trace token, tagag-tafog: htk6_5ed18c

## Runbook: SDK Parity Checks (Corvela)

Support folks — when a customer says "it works in the Corvela JS SDK but not in Python," don't panic. The two SDKs lag each other by about one release; check the parity matrix first before filing a bug.

To reproduce issues yourself, run the parity harness against the internal staging API. It spins up both SDKs and diffs responses automatically.

The harness needs credentials for the staging gateway. Use this key:

gateway credential: kto23_LX9A4ys6i4nzHtpOLNLodKK

Ticket: Bloom filter config drift — Keystrand cache layer

Blocking the 7.3 release. The bloom filter fronting the Keystrand KV store has drifted between canary and fleet: canary runs a larger bit array and one extra hash function, so false-positive rates differ by an order of magnitude and the canary metrics are meaningless for sign-off. Need fleet brought in line before we can compare. No code change required, config-only. Do not ship until parity is confirmed. Canary currently runs with the following values.

settings of yageg-yahap:
[gorael]
team = olieth
access_code = ac_941d74
owner = brieth.aldiel
host = gorael.tolvaqio.internal
port = 6379
peer = briwyn.urlaqtech.internal
salt = 116e6622
pin = 1957

Service Accounts — Fabrikoan Test-Data Factory

The Fabrikoan library seeds fixtures through a dedicated service account per environment. Never run it with personal credentials. Factories call the internal seeding API, which enforces rate limits and tenant isolation. Rotate the account quarterly; the rotation script lives in the tools repo. For local development, the factory client authenticates with the key below.

service key, bajog-yahop: kto7_mMHVCpJ